Night shift onboarding — Pellgate Tower. The evacuation-chair store is on Level 3, opposite the goods lift. It holds two chairs, spare straps, and a torch; check the seal on the door during your first round and log it. Chairs must never be moved except for drills or emergencies. If the seal is broken or a chair is needed, open the store with the code below.

staff pass of fajeg-fawig = bdg-EYUES-74230

## Runbook: encoding detection failures

When an uploaded text file fails ingestion in Glyphsort, check the detector log first. Most failures are mislabeled UTF-16 files. Re-run detection with the fallback chain enabled; don't hand-edit files. Escalate only if confidence stays below threshold after two passes. The detector runs with these configuration values:

config for yajep-tafof:
[rusath]
team = julmir
access_code = ac_fe37fd
host = rusath.novactech.test
port = 8000
owner = pelmir.weneth
peer = oliwyn.olvarqdyn.internal

Subject: Quickstore 4.2 — bloom filter now fronts the KV layer

Plugin authors: starting with this release, Quickstore places a bloom filter ahead of the key-value store. Negative lookups return faster; false positives fall through safely. No API changes are required on your side. Verify your plugin against the staging build referenced below.

session token of fahif-tadup = htk3_9c7